    OH suggested last night doing christmas puddings in little muffin cases..............he said to wrap the flannel round a chocolate orange ( or even real orange?) -elastic band to secure it and that part goes on the bottom. Cut a piece of white felt in a random shape to resemble cream and pop holly decoration on top. I did try it with a tennis ball (minus felt and holly)but the flannels I've got are a bit too thick .............I got some brown ones last year that were smaller and thinner -can't remember where from.
